Comparison of conventional CT and VT with current and voltage sensors
Dvořák, Petr ; Drápela, Jiří (referee) ; Orságová, Jaroslava (advisor)
The diploma thesis deals with conventional transformers and current and voltage sensors. The first half of thesis describes mainly the basic concepts and accuracy classes of these converters used in electrical substations. The emphasis is given primarily on the differences. In the second half of thesis is presented an exact type of converters, which are installed in the substation Medlánky. There is an analysis of measured data from long – term monitoring from this substation and comparing the results from conventional transformers compared to the results from more modern sensors.

Converters for HVDC Energy Transmission
Martinec, Roman ; Klíma, Bohumil (referee) ; Červinka, Dalibor (advisor)
The aim of this thesis is to introduce the high-voltage direct current (HVDC) systems used in the world today. The work lists the basic principles of connection between individual HVDC stations, as well as the configuration of the HVDC transmission link. In addition, the work describes the topologies of converters currently in use and also their principal semi-conductor components. In the conclusion of the thesis, the HVDC technology is assessed, including its advantages and drawbacks.
Matlab models of DC/DC converters with transformer
Michalík, Martin ; Knobloch, Jan (referee) ; Pazdera, Ivo (advisor)
The aim of the Bachelor thesis was getting in touch with standard topologies of DC/DC converters with transformer, their realization in programming environment Matlab/Simulink with usage of Simscape library and processing the results of simulations. Part of work is given to theory of transformers and design of transformers model, which is important part of every DC/DC converter with transformer. Model of transformer is based on theoretical background and functionality is checked up by reference model. The main part is aimed to enlighten functionality of different variety of DC/DC converters with transformer, creating their models in programming environment Matlab/Simulink, simulate those models and process results of simulations.

Switched laboratory power source
Divílek, Petr ; Havlíček, Tomáš (referee) ; Pavlík, Michal (advisor)
The main aim of this work is to provide an overall summary of the problem of switched power supply. The stepwise description of the circuit components and their functions explains the way how the switching power supplies work. Bachelor thesis is focused on description, simulation and design of switching power supply powered by current PC of the ATX resource, where 12 V is used.
